Context: IEM (Intel Extreme Masters) is a 20-year-old esports tournament series operated by ESL FACEIT Group. Historically centered on Counter-Strike, it functions as a global touring circuit with stops in Katowice, Cologne, and now Beijing. The announcement, as parsed, confirms only that IEM Beijing 2026 will happen and that invites are being sent. No game title, no team list, no prize pool, no venue, no broadcast partner. Regulatory & Compliance: The report identifies three major risks: multi-department approval for international events in China, content censorship (team names, player statements), and cross-border data transfer under PIPL. It correctly notes that the event itself has no crypto assets, so virtual currency regulation does not apply. But the report misses a nuance: if the event ever integrates blockchain, it must comply with China’s ban on cryptocurrency trading and NFT securitization. The report’s confidence is "medium" for regulation. I would raise that to high because the legal framework is clear. The risk is not the rules; it is the execution of approval. The report’s suggestion that the event could receive government subsidies is plausible, but only if the event avoids any crypto association. The moment a token is mentioned, the regulatory environment flips from supportive to hostile.
